China Visitors Summit welcomes TRAVTALK as media partner

The China Visitors Summit (CVS) is thrilled to announce TRAVTALK as a valued media partner for our upcoming CVS Middle East event in Dubai, September 5-6 and Doha September 9-10, 2024. Alexander Glos, CEO of China i2i Group and producer of CVS, expressed his enthusiasm, stating, “Since CVS’s inception in 2008, we’ve collaborated with various media partners to enhance the summit’s reach and value for travel suppliers. By partnering with a diverse array of media outlets, CVS provides a unique platform for travel suppliers to amplify their messaging and connect with a broader audience, fostering new business development opportunities.” TRAVTALK, a pioneering English B2B travel trade media company in the UAE for over two decades, offers a comprehensive suite of services, including the monthly printed magazine TravTalkME, the daily news website www.tourismbreakingnews.ae, and the innovative online news capsule www.traveltvmiddleeast.news. Audience and Coverage: TRAVTALK’s audience comprises industry decision-makers such as company owners, CEOs, directors, and senior management across the travel, tourism, and hospitality sectors. Their B2B print and electronic formats reach audiences throughout the UAE, GCC, and the wider Middle East region, including travel agents, tour operators, hospitality establishments, airlines, and more. Daily Updates and Partnerships: In addition to their comprehensive coverage, TRAVTALK provides daily updates via WhatsApp, delivering four key breaking news items from Monday to Friday. They have established media partnerships with prestigious industry events such as ATM, WTM, Riyadh Travel Fair, and ITB Berlin, among others.

TravTalk ME media partners with Qatar Travel Mart 2023

TravTalk Middle East was the official media partner for the second edition of Qatar Travel Mart which kicked off today in Doha. This year, QTM is set to offer an array of impactful events including an international conference, the Global Village exhibition, a prestigious Gala Dinner, an Awards Ceremony, and a thoughtfully designed Hosted Buyers’ Program. These components are tailored to enhance business-to-business (B2B) prospects. In addition, there will be media familiarization trips and cultural tours. These endeavors collectively aim to cater to the needs of both inbound and outbound travel and tourism enterprises. QTM 2023 will serve as a unifying platform where local and international Destination Management Companies (DMCs), Tour Operators, Travel Agencies, Travel Technology Companies, Associations, and Tourism Boards will converge. TravTalk media partners with Sharjah tourism @WTM

TravTalk Middle East participates as official B2B media partner for Sharjah Commerce and Tourism Development Authority (SCTDA) at the World Travel Market 2022 (WTM). This year will be the first time that almost every destination has fully opened for travel hence as WTM witnesses new exhibitors the total expected number exceeds 51,000 industry professionals from the travel and tourism industry in the British capital from 7-9 November. TravTalk Middle East has been the official media partner for WTM London for the past many years.  SCTDA will further its strategic goals of promoting the emirate as a popular travel destination on prestigious global events. They are leading a delegation of 17 public and private sector entities, namely, Environment and Protected Areas Authority (EPAA), Sharjah International Airport, Sharjah Investment and Development Authority (Shurooq), Sharjah Art Foundation (SAF), Expo Centre Sharjah, Sharjah Institute for Heritage, Sharjah Sports Council, Sharjah Old Cars Club, Sharjah Airport Travel Agency (SATA), Sharjah National Hotels, Golden Sands Hotel, The Chedi Al Bait Hotel, Al Badayer Retreat by Mysk, Sheraton Sharjah Beach Resort & Spa, Coral Beach Resort Sharjah,COSMO Travel, and TravTalk, the official B2B media partner. These entities will showcase their latest developments across the emirate, including key projects taking shape in key sectors of tourism, leisure, heritage, culture, sports and hospitality, along with the steps they are taking to preserve Sharjah’s rich biodiversity and cultural heritage. Through their participation, SCTDA will also highlight its new developments and projects, tourism offerings and services, staycation options and hotel establishments across the emirate. H.E.
